  1. Progress and hold-ups in CarboEurope intercomparison activities News on sausages, grapefruits, cucumbers Armin Jordan Max-Planck-Institute for Biogeochemistry 07701 Jena, Germany

  2. Main goals • assure comparability of atmospheric data so that these can • be merged more confidently • identify, quantify, and reduce, calibration scale offsets • detect concentration dependent deviations • indicator for malfunctioning of analytical systems • flask data and continuous data

BUT….. • Not yet useful as tool for detection of problems in near time • because of • delayed data sumission / wrong data format • delayed / incomplete web updates • inadequate quality check of submitted data by participants • for many species offsets are documented but not reduced • modification of web presentation pending for over 1 year

  7. Grapefruit Flask Intercomparison (1) • double frequency of intercomparison • all labs compare identical sample from the same flask • → check of sausages

Cucumbers (3) • News since Crete 2006 meeting: • New cylinders have been purchased with DIN 14 valves instead of CGA590 • Cylinders have been filled and spiked in Jena • Storage test indicate stability of mixtures • Boxes have foam housing for regulators • All pressure regulators equipped with • New DIN 14 connectors • Plugs on both ends • inlet filters • outlet quick connect couplings

  12. Pressure regulators still weak part of the system: • DIN14 connection has not made the system more robust: • PCTFE sealing gaskets broke (four types tested) • (loss of ¼ cylinder filling) • regulators to be handled with great care • first stage membrane broken with 3 regulators
